<p><strong>The actual procedure<br />
</strong><br />
To attend a police auction or the government auction in Nashville TN the first step is to get registered. The auction firms conducting the auction sets up office and one can go and get registered here. This registration is also done at the local police station or you would be given instructions regarding the same. Usually this registration is free of charge but some auction firms charge a minimum amount as the registration fee so that the serious buyers are distinguished. The lists of cars that are going to be put up for auction are given to the customers once the registration is over. The details of the auction like the date, the venue are all specified and informed to the customer.</p>
<p>The details of the cars in Nashville are especially useful since the customer can actually go through the list and come to a decision as to the choice of the car. On the day of the auction the customer can take along a mechanic and he is allowed entry after checking the registration. The customer is allowed to check the cars he is interested in thoroughly. The bidding begins on one car at a time. This procedure is a bit slow and by the time the car of your interest comes for bidding it might be a while. The bidding continues and the highest bidder wins the bid. Once the bidding is over the money has to be paid and the legal papers of the car is transferred to the winner’s name. The car is ready to be taken home.</p>

<strong>Open the classifieds:</strong> The first step involved in locating a car auction is to regularly go through the local classifieds. These newspapers are a rich source of information since putting up advertisements in classifieds is very cheap and yields an excellent response also. There are some specialized vehicle newspapers and magazines available that publish the auction venues, dates and vehicle lists also.</p>
<p><strong>Local car auctions are a better choice:</strong> A public car auction near you may turn out to be a great place where you could strike a fantastic bargain. Usually, visiting a local car auction proves to be a better decision, for you save the fuel, time and extra effort that would be used in reaching an auction far away. Such auctions are smaller than national ones and are restricted to specific areas. Apart from this, local car auctions have lesser competition which means that the bidding war does not touch great heights and the customer stands to gain by striking a good bargain. If you have something specific on your mind, then there might be no competition at all.</p>
<p><strong>Take help from car auction websites:</strong> The internet can be a great help to anybody who is willing to visit their first car auction. No matter where you are living, online information is readily available that guides you to the auctions planned in your city and state. Information about auctions that might be happening at a very close location may also prove useful. Most internet sites related to car auctions will provide you with lists of vehicles being put up for sale, starting bids and vehicle identification numbers for many auctions or whenever such information is available.</p>
<p><strong>Keep your ears open for word of mouth publicity:</strong> Not all car auctions are heavily publicized through newspapers or the internet because they are held by private auction companies who do not have big budgets for supporting advertising campaigns. These auctions are not even available on the internet and solely depend on word of mouth publicity. Bargain-wise, such places prove to be ideal because the number of bidders involved is less. Also, such auctions do not aim at high profit margins and subsequently, offer their buyers a good deal.</p>
